How to Choose an Amplifier for Car Speakers?

When it comes to upgrading the audio system in your vehicle, one important component to consider is the amplifier. An amplifier boosts the electrical signal from your car’s head unit and sends it to your speakers, resulting in a higher volume and improved sound quality. However, with so many options available on the market, it can be difficult to know which amplifier is the best fit for your car speakers. This guide will provide in-depth information on the different types of amplifiers, their features, and how to choose the right one for your vehicle.

Types of Amplifiers
There are two main types of amplifiers: Class A and Class D. Class A amplifiers are known for their high-quality sound, but they are also relatively inefficient and can generate a lot of heat. Class D amplifiers, on the other hand, are more efficient and produce less heat, but they may not provide the same level of sound quality.

Class A Amplifiers
Class A amplifiers are the traditional type of amplifier and are known for their high-quality sound reproduction. They are characterized by their linearity, which means that the output signal is a direct replica of the input signal. This results in minimal distortion and a more natural, accurate sound. However, Class A amplifiers are relatively inefficient, and as a result, they can generate a lot of heat. This can be an issue in a small, enclosed space like a car, and may require additional cooling systems.

Class D Amplifiers
Class D amplifiers are a newer technology that have gained popularity in recent years. They are known for their efficiency, as they convert the input signal into a series of pulses and only amplify the pulses that represent the audio signal. This results in less heat being generated and a more compact design. However, the nature of the pulse modulation can result in distortion at high volumes, which can negatively impact sound quality.

Amplifier Features
When choosing an amplifier for your car speakers, there are several features to consider.

Power Output
The power output of an amplifier is measured in watts and is an important factor to consider when choosing an amplifier. A higher wattage amplifier will produce a louder sound, but it’s also important to match the power output of the amplifier to the power handling capabilities of your speakers. If the amplifier has a higher power output than the speakers can handle, it can cause damage to the speakers.

Crossover
A crossover is a circuit that separates the audio signals into different frequency ranges, such as high, mid, and low. This allows you to adjust the balance of the sound and tailor it to your preferences. Some amplifiers come with built-in crossovers, while others may require an external crossover to be added.

Number of Channels
The number of channels on an amplifier determines how many speakers it can power. A two-channel amplifier can power two speakers, a four-channel amplifier can power four speakers, and so on. If you’re planning on adding more speakers to your car audio system in the future, it’s important to choose an amplifier with enough channels to accommodate them.
